Overview
A Computational Biophysicist uses computer-based simulations and mathematical models to study the structure, dynamics, and interactions of biological molecules. By bridging physics, biology, and computer science, they help uncover molecular mechanisms that drive life processes and support innovations in drug design, biotechnology, and nanomedicine.

Job Description
Develop and apply molecular dynamics simulations to study protein folding, ligand binding, and molecular interactions.
Create mathematical and computational models to predict biomolecular behaviour under various physiological conditions.
Analyze large-scale biological datasets and integrate experimental data to refine computational predictions.
Collaborate with experimental biophysicists, chemists, and biomedical engineers to translate computational insights into real-world applications.
Publish research findings and contribute to advancements in computational biology, structural bioinformatics, and biophysical modelling.
